是一种安全措施,用于验证和过滤批处理文件中的输入数据,以防止潜在的安全漏洞和错误。这种检查可以确保输入数据的合法性和正确性,从而提高系统的安全性和稳定性。
自动检查批处理文件中的输入可以通过以下步骤实现:
- 输入验证:对于批处理文件中的每个输入参数,应该进行验证以确保其符合预期的格式和类型。例如,可以使用正则表达式来验证输入是否符合特定的模式,或者使用类型转换函数来确保输入是正确的数据类型。
- 输入过滤:对于批处理文件中的输入,应该进行过滤以防止恶意输入或非法字符的注入。可以使用输入过滤函数或过滤器来删除或转义输入中的特殊字符,以防止代码注入、跨站点脚本攻击等安全威胁。
- 错误处理:在批处理文件中,应该对输入参数的错误进行适当的处理和报告。例如,如果输入参数缺失或格式错误,可以输出错误消息并终止批处理的执行,以避免可能的错误操作或数据损坏。
自动检查批处理文件中的输入可以提供以下优势:
- 安全性:通过验证和过滤输入数据,可以防止潜在的安全漏洞和攻击,保护系统和数据的安全性。
- 稳定性:通过确保输入数据的合法性和正确性,可以减少错误和异常情况的发生,提高系统的稳定性和可靠性。
- 效率:通过自动检查输入,可以减少手动检查和纠正输入数据的工作量,提高开发和维护的效率。
自动检查批处理文件中的输入在各种应用场景中都非常有用,特别是在需要处理用户输入或外部数据的情况下。例如:
- 网络应用程序:对于接收用户输入的网络应用程序,自动检查输入可以防止跨站点脚本攻击、SQL注入等安全威胁。
- 数据处理:对于需要处理大量数据的批处理任务,自动检查输入可以确保输入数据的正确性和一致性,避免数据错误导致的问题。
- 系统管理:对于需要执行系统管理任务的批处理脚本,自动检查输入可以防止误操作和错误参数导致的系统故障。
腾讯云提供了一系列与云计算相关的产品和服务,可以帮助实现自动检查批处理文件中的输入的安全措施。例如:
- 腾讯云Web应用防火墙(WAF):用于保护Web应用程序免受常见的网络攻击,包括SQL注入、跨站点脚本攻击等。
- 腾讯云安全组:用于配置网络访问控制规则,限制对批处理脚本的访问和输入。
- 腾讯云云服务器(CVM):提供可靠的虚拟服务器实例,用于执行批处理任务和管理系统。
- 腾讯云数据库(TencentDB):提供高性能、可扩展的数据库服务,用于存储和管理批处理脚本的输入和输出数据。
请注意,以上仅为腾讯云的一些相关产品和服务示例,其他云计算品牌商也提供类似的产品和服务,具体选择应根据实际需求和预算来决定。